The Black Diamond Farmers Market, now in its second year, is accepting applications for the 2014 season.
A board of advisors has joined the team, and planning for special events, activities and entertainment will punctuate this year’s Friday market.
“I’m so pleased with the results of our first season,” said manager Mira Hoke in a statement. “The community, the vendors and this tremendous location added up to the right market at the right time.”
Hoke added that the city of Black Diamond has no supermarket, and folks like to keep their dollars local, if possible.
In addition, the BDFM is offering an information cart for local businesses who would like to provide brochures, maps or menus to promote themselves to visitors and locals.
